Transaction f8aba19e27917a270e4c4add190c76123af5d52abd22a36e1663aed99d8d3aa8
1 Input
1 Output
-
f8aba19e27917a270e4c4add190c76123af5d52abd22a36e1663aed99d8d3aa8:0
- value
- 26273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ab3c7d5bf8bd41c5d41b596a24b2d63f49749dd OP_EQUAL
- address
- 3CsojKfB34kQHPV2AhEGzMVhS7JTdKP9SM